Jeffrey Schwarz is an Emmy Award-winning filmmaker based in Los Angeles. His latest documentary is "Mineshaft: The Cruising Murders," which premiered at Tribeca Film Festival in 2026. Other films include "Commitment to Life," "Boulevard! A Hollywood Story," "The Fabulous Allan Carr," "Tab Hunter Confidential," "I Am Divine," "Wrangler: Anatomy of an Icon," "Spine Tingler! The William Castle Story," and HBO Documentary Films’ "Vito." He is executive producer of "Hollywood Black" (2024), the Emmy-nominated MGM+ series directed by Justin Simien, which won the 2025 Independent Spirit Award for Best New Non-Scripted or Documentary Series. Schwarz is also the recipient of the 2015 Frameline Award for outstanding contribution to LGBTQ representation in film, television, and the media arts.
